When you're ready to venture outside, the world-renowned Magen's Bay Beach is a mere five-minute drive away. Plunge into the emerald waters, feel the fine sand between your toes, or simply lounge under the coconut palms, soaking in the island vibe. A short ten-minute drive transports you to downtown Charlotte Amalie, St. Thomas' vibrant capital. Here, a tapestry of brick sidewalks, charming boutiques, jewelry shops, and history-laden architecture awaits. Immerse yourself in the local culture, sample the island's cuisine, and get lost in the colorful splendor of this charming town - all duty-free!.
Just a little further, a 12-15 minute drive leads you to Red Hook, on the East End of St. Thomas. A bustling hub, Red Hook offers an array of restaurants, shopping options, and is the ferry departure point to the neighboring island of St. John. A day trip to explore its pristine beaches and untouched natural beauty is a must.

Fort Christian is a captivating historic fortress in Charlotte Amalie, offering visitors a rare glimpse into over 300 years of Virgin Islands history, from colonial defense and governance to its later roles as a prison and museum. History enthusiasts and culture seekers will enjoy exploring its thick walls, iconic clock tower, and rich stories of pirates, governors, and settlers.
